How can I deploy containerized applications to Azure Kubernetes Service (AKS)?

Asked by Last Modified  

Follow 1
Answer

Please enter your answer

Microsoft Azure Training Expert on UrbanPro.com: Deploying Containerized Applications to Azure Kubernetes Service (AKS) Overview As a seasoned tutor specializing in Microsoft Azure Training, I understand the importance of deploying containerized applications to Azure Kubernetes Service (AKS). Below...
read more
Microsoft Azure Training Expert on UrbanPro.com: Deploying Containerized Applications to Azure Kubernetes Service (AKS) Overview As a seasoned tutor specializing in Microsoft Azure Training, I understand the importance of deploying containerized applications to Azure Kubernetes Service (AKS). Below is a comprehensive guide on the process, emphasizing key concepts and steps to ensure a smooth deployment. Prerequisites for Microsoft Azure Training: Before diving into AKS deployment, it's crucial to ensure that you have the following prerequisites in place: Azure subscription: Make sure you have an active Azure subscription. Azure CLI or Azure PowerShell: Install the Azure Command-Line Interface (CLI) or Azure PowerShell for efficient management. Docker: Familiarize yourself with Docker for containerization of applications. Step-by-Step Guide for Deploying Containerized Applications to AKS: Create an AKS Cluster: Use Azure CLI or Azure Portal to create an AKS cluster. Specify the desired configurations such as resource group, region, and node count. Configure kubectl: Install and configure kubectl, the command-line tool for interacting with AKS clusters. Connect kubectl to your AKS cluster for seamless communication. Containerize Your Application: Dockerize your application by creating a Dockerfile. Build a Docker image and push it to a container registry (e.g., Azure Container Registry). Deploy Azure Kubernetes Service (AKS): Utilize the YAML manifest file to define your application deployment on AKS. Apply the configuration using kubectl apply to deploy your application to AKS. Scaling and Monitoring: Implement Horizontal Pod Autoscaling (HPA) for automatic scaling based on resource usage. Leverage Azure Monitor and Azure Log Analytics for monitoring your AKS cluster and applications. Update and Rollback: Use rolling updates to deploy application updates without downtime. Implement rollback strategies in case of issues during the deployment process. Network Configuration: Configure Azure Virtual Network and Network Policies for secure communication within the AKS cluster. Integration with Azure DevOps: Integrate your AKS deployment with Azure DevOps for streamlined CI/CD pipelines. Automate the deployment process for enhanced efficiency. Best Online Coaching for Microsoft Azure Training: For a more in-depth understanding and hands-on experience with deploying containerized applications to AKS, consider enrolling in the best online coaching for Microsoft Azure Training. Look for courses that cover: Practical AKS deployment scenarios. Real-world examples and case studies. Hands-on labs and assignments. By following these steps and considering online coaching options, you'll be well-equipped to deploy containerized applications to Azure Kubernetes Service effectively as part of your Microsoft Azure Training journey. read less
Comments

Related Questions

I have 8+ years of experience in IT operations, and I am planning to switch to DevOps, AWS, Azure. Please suggest.

You can start with Azure Infrastructure ( Azure Admin) learning later try to get real-time experience then plan for Azure Solution architect. While your experience growing learns PAAS components and concentrate...
Shiva
Please give me brief description about microsoft azure, AWS and cloud computing.
Cloud computing is internet-based computing whereby shared resources, software, and information are provided to computers and other devices on-demand.Large enterprises have been using the cloud for years...
Madhur
0 0
6

What would be the career path after doing Microsoft Azure?

All IT companies are moving to cloud.So you will be having Bright futurAll IT companies are moving to the cloud. So you will have Bright future
Nikhil
0 0
5

Now ask question in any of the 1000+ Categories, and get Answers from Tutors and Trainers on UrbanPro.com

Ask a Question

Related Lessons

Azure Storage Gen1 VS Azure Storage Gen1
We have azure storage from the beginning now Microsoft Azure introduce azure Storage Gen2, here we have BLOB+Data Lake Gen2 is combined But we should remember here for few features of data lake gen...
M

Azure Course Content
Microsoft Azure Course Content Lesson 1: Introduction to Azure Overview of On-premise infrastructure The transition from On-premise to datacenter housing & managed data centres and finally...

OAuth Authentication (without using ADAL) to Dynamics 365 using Azure Apps
Here I am going to show without using ADAL(active directory authentication library) how to get the authentication token and how to connect to CRM from a standalone HTML Page using the web-API. I will...

Difference between App services,Cloud Service and Virtual Machine in Microsoft Azure
App Services :When you want to deploy your application to Azure IIS conatainers without requiring any control,web apps should be preferred.It's a part of Azure Paas.1) When you need IIS.2) Satisfy with...

Difference between Union and Union All
Both Union and Union All are Used to Join Rows of two or more tables.But the Union Or Union All need the datatype same. Let's Understand with the below example. Difference-1 UnionUnion will combine...

Recommended Articles

Microsoft Office is a very popular tool amongst students and C-Suite. Today, approximately 1.2 billion people across 140 countries use the office programme. It is used at home, schools and offices on a daily basis for organizing, handling and presenting data and information. Microsoft Office Suite offers programs that can...

Read full article >

Hadoop is a framework which has been developed for organizing and analysing big chunks of data for a business. Suppose you have a file larger than your system’s storage capacity and you can’t store it. Hadoop helps in storing bigger files than what could be stored on one particular server. You can therefore store very,...

Read full article >

Microsoft Excel is an electronic spreadsheet tool which is commonly used for financial and statistical data processing. It has been developed by Microsoft and forms a major component of the widely used Microsoft Office. From individual users to the top IT companies, Excel is used worldwide. Excel is one of the most important...

Read full article >

Whether it was the Internet Era of 90s or the Big Data Era of today, Information Technology (IT) has given birth to several lucrative career options for many. Though there will not be a “significant" increase in demand for IT professionals in 2014 as compared to 2013, a “steady” demand for IT professionals is rest assured...

Read full article >

Looking for Microsoft Azure Training ?

Learn from the Best Tutors on UrbanPro

Are you a Tutor or Training Institute?

Join UrbanPro Today to find students near you